# Bun Bundler
Bun's bundler is a fast JavaScript/TypeScript bundler built on the same engine as Bun's runtime. It's an esbuild-compatible alternative with native performance.
## Quick Start
### CLI
```bash
# Basic bundle
bun build ./src/index.ts --outdir ./dist
# Production build
bun build ./src/index.ts --outdir ./dist --minify
# Multiple entry points
bun build ./src/index.ts ./src/worker.ts --outdir ./dist
```
### JavaScript API
```typescript
// Since Bun 1.2, Bun.build REJECTS on failure (throws).
// Wrap in try/catch to handle errors; pass { throw: false } to restore the
// old resolve-with-{ success, logs } contract if you prefer that style.
try {
const result = await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
outdir: "./dist",
});
console.log(`Built ${result.outputs.length} files`);
} catch (err) {
console.error("Build failed:", err);
process.exit(1);
}
```
## Bun.build Options
```typescript
await Bun.build({
// Entry points (required)
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
// Output directory
outdir: "./dist",
// Target environment
target: "browser", // "browser" | "bun" | "node"
// Output format
format: "esm", // "esm" | "cjs" | "iife"
// Minification
minify: true, // or { whitespace: true, identifiers: true, syntax: true }
// Code splitting
splitting: true,
// Source maps
sourcemap: "external", // "none" | "inline" | "external" | "linked"
// Naming patterns
naming: {
entry: "[dir]/[name].[ext]",
chunk: "[name]-[hash].[ext]",
asset: "[name]-[hash].[ext]",
},
// Define globals
define: {
"process.env.NODE_ENV": JSON.stringify("production"),
},
// External packages
external: ["react", "react-dom"],
// Loaders
loader: {
".svg": "text",
".png": "file",
},
// Plugins
plugins: [myPlugin],
// Root directory
root: "./src",
// Public path for assets
publicPath: "/static/",
});
```
## CLI Flags
```bash
bun build <entrypoints> [flags]
```
| Flag | Description |
|------|-------------|
| `--outdir` | Output directory |
| `--outfile` | Output single file |
| `--target` | `browser`, `bun`, `node` |
| `--format` | `esm`, `cjs`, `iife` |
| `--minify` | Enable minification |
| `--minify-whitespace` | Minify whitespace only |
| `--minify-identifiers` | Minify identifiers only |
| `--minify-syntax` | Minify syntax only |
| `--splitting` | Enable code splitting |
| `--sourcemap` | `none`, `inline`, `external`, `linked` |
| `--external` | Mark packages as external |
| `--define` | Define compile-time constants |
| `--loader` | Custom loaders for extensions |
| `--public-path` | Public path for assets |
| `--root` | Root directory |
| `--entry-naming` | Entry point naming pattern |
| `--chunk-naming` | Chunk naming pattern |
| `--asset-naming` | Asset naming pattern |
## Target Environments
### Browser (default)
```typescript
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
target: "browser",
outdir: "./dist",
});
```
### Bun Runtime
```typescript
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/server.ts"],
target: "bun",
outdir: "./dist",
});
```
### Node.js
```typescript
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/server.ts"],
target: "node",
outdir: "./dist",
});
```
## Code Splitting
```typescript
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ts", "./src/admin.ts"],
splitting: true,
outdir: "./dist",
});
```
Shared dependencies are extracted into separate chunks automatically.
## Loaders
| Loader | Extensions | Output |
|--------|------------|--------|
| `js` | `.js`, `.mjs`, `.cjs` | JavaScript |
| `jsx` | `.jsx` | JavaScript |
| `ts` | `.ts`, `.mts`, `.cts` | JavaScript |
| `tsx` | `.tsx` | JavaScript |
| `json` | `.json` | JavaScript |
| `toml` | `.toml` | JavaScript |
| `text` | - | String export |
| `file` | - | File path export |
| `base64` | - | Base64 string |
| `dataurl` | - | Data URL |
| `css` | `.css` | CSS file |
Custom loaders:
```typescript
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
loader: {
".svg": "text",
".png": "file",
".woff2": "file",
},
});
```
## Plugins
```typescript
const myPlugin = {
name: "my-plugin",
setup(build) {
// Resolve hook
build.onResolve({ filter: /\.special$/ }, (args) => {
return { path: args.path, namespace: "special" };
});
// Load hook
build.onLoad({ filter: /.*/, namespace: "special" }, (args) => {
return {
contents: `export default "special"`,
loader: "js",
};
});
},
};
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
plugins: [myPlugin],
});
```
## Build Output
```typescript
// Bun 1.2+: Bun.build rejects on failure. Use try/catch to surface build
// errors (or pass { throw: false } and keep the legacy { success, logs } shape).
try {
const result = await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
outdir: "./dist",
});
// Access outputs
for (const output of result.outputs) {
console.log(output.path); // File path
console.log(output.kind); // "entry-point" | "chunk" | "asset"
console.log(output.hash); // Content hash
console.log(output.loader); // Loader used
// Read content
const text = await output.text();
}
} catch (err) {
console.error("Build failed:", err);
process.exit(1);
}
```
## Common Patterns
### Production Build
```typescript
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
outdir: "./dist",
target: "browser",
minify: true,
sourcemap: "external",
splitting: true,
define: {
"process.env.NODE_ENV": JSON.stringify("production"),
},
});
```
### Library Build
```typescript
await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
outdir: "./dist",
target: "bun",
format: "esm",
external: ["*"], // Externalize all dependencies
sourcemap: "external",
});
```
### Build Script
```typescript
// build.ts
// Bun 1.2+: Bun.build rejects on failure, so try/catch is the modern idiom.
try {
const result = await Bun.build({
entrypoints: ["./src/index.ts"],
outdir: "./dist",
minify: process.env.NODE_ENV === "production",
});
console.log(`Built ${result.outputs.length} files`);
} catch (err) {
console.error("Build failed:", err);
process.exit(1);
}
```
Run: `bun run build.ts`
## Common Errors
| Error | Cause | Fix |
|-------|-------|-----|
| `Could not resolve` | Missing import | Install package or fix path |
| `No matching export` | Named export missing | Check export name |
| `Unexpected token` | Syntax error | Fix source code |
| `Target not supported` | Invalid target | Use `browser`, `bun`, or `node` |
